** The kitchen remodeling market in the Melrose neighborhood of the Bronx is competitive and service-oriented, characterized by a mix of long-standing local contractors and larger NYC-based firms that serve the area. The housing stock largely consists of pre-war apartments and some older townhouses, which creates a high demand for contractors skilled in space optimization and updating outdated electrical and plumbing systems. The average quality of providers is good, with top-rated firms demonstrating strong expertise in managing the complexities of NYC building codes and co-op/board approvals. Typical pricing for a full kitchen remodel in this area can vary widely based on scope and materials. A moderate renovation with semi-custom cabinets and quartz countertops typically ranges from **$25,000 to $45,000**, while high-end projects with custom cabinetry, premium appliances, and significant layout changes can easily exceed **$70,000**. Homeowners are advised to verify NYC DOB licensing, insurance, and check references thoroughly before committing to a project.

For a full remodel in Melrose, including new cabinets, countertops, appliances, flooring, and labor, homeowners should budget between $25,000 and $60,000+, with mid-range projects typically landing in the $35,000-$45,000 range. Costs are influenced by Long Island's higher labor and material prices, the age of your home (which may require updates to plumbing/electrical to meet current NY codes), and your choice of finishes. Getting multiple detailed quotes from local contractors is crucial for an accurate estimate.
A full kitchen remodel in Melrose typically takes 6 to 12 weeks from demolition to completion, accounting for potential delays in material deliveries and the thoroughness required for older homes. It's advisable to plan major demolition and construction for spring or fall to avoid the peak humidity of Long Island summers, which can affect drying times for drywall and paint, and the deep winter when subcontractor schedules can be impacted by weather.

This is a vital local consideration. Adding a pot-filler, dishwasher, or garbage disposal significantly increases water usage and waste, which can strain your septic system's capacity. You must consult with your contractor and possibly a septic professional to assess if your current system can handle the load or requires an upgrade, which must be factored into your budget and timeline. Brookhaven may have specific regulations regarding septic expansions.
